LAST PRICE - AT THE CLOSE
NPO is UP 12% since the begininning of the year
NPO is DOWN -9% BELOW 20 day SMA
NPO is UP 8% ABOVE 200 day SMA
PROFITABLE: YES
EPS: $2.03
EARNINGS MOMENTUM: NO
0.04% DECREASE IN QTRLY EARNINGS
P/E RATIO IS: 50.8628
INCOME TO DEBT RATIO: 0.18
![]() |
THE STOCK IS 15.9% AWAY FROM ALL-TIME HIGHS OF $286.345 |
![]() |
NPO IS UP 12% SINCE THE BEGINNING OF THE YEAR |
![]() |
NPO IS UP 42% OVER THE PAST 12 MONTHS |
![]() |
NPO IS DOWN -13% OVER THE PAST 1 MONTH |
![]() |
2% OF ALL NPO INVESTORS ARE BETTING AGAINST NPO |
![]() |
NUM INVESTORS SHORT NPO HAS GONE DOWN 15% VERSUS LAST MONTH |
![]() |
NPO moved up 0 in the previous minute |
![]() |
NPO is up 0 over the last hour |
![]() |
NPO is up 6.5% over the last 5 days |
![]() |
NPO is 5 above its 8 day SMA |
| $233.71 | ![]() DAY |
$252.85 |
| $243.99 | ![]() PREVIOUS DAY |
$253.26 |
| $239.12 | ![]() WEEK |
$260.49 |
| $239.12 | ![]() ![]() MONTH |
$286.35 |
| $133.50 | ![]() YEAR |
$286.35 |
NPO is mentioned N/A less than normal on
NPO is mentioned N/A times in an average day on